Understanding Bitcoin: A Digital Revolution
Bitcoin (BTC) isn't tangible currency like traditional banknotes—it exists purely in digital form. Created in 2009 by the pseudonymous Satoshi Nakamoto, it operates on a peer-to-peer network architecture with these defining features:
- Decentralized ledger technology: Unlike bank-controlled databases, Bitcoin transactions record on a public blockchain
- Cryptographic security: Uses public-key cryptography for wallet addresses and private keys
- Limited supply: Capped at 21 million coins through programmed issuance schedule

Key Characteristics of Bitcoin
1. Predictable Monetary Policy
The Bitcoin protocol enforces strict emission rules:
- Initial block reward: 50 BTC (2009)
- Current block reward: 6.25 BTC (2020 halving)
- Total supply cap: 21 million BTC (~2140)
This contrasts sharply with fiat currencies subject to central bank monetary policies.
2. Pseudonymous Transactions
While offering more privacy than traditional banking, Bitcoin transactions:
- Don't require personal identification
- Record permanently on public blockchain
- Enable forensic analysis of transaction patterns
3. Energy-Intensive Mining
The proof-of-work consensus mechanism:
- Requires specialized hardware (ASICs)
- Consumes significant electricity (~150 TWh/year)
- Incentivizes miners through block rewards and fees
Market Dynamics and Volatility
Bitcoin's price fluctuations stem from:
- Limited adoption as medium of exchange
- Speculative trading activity
- Regulatory uncertainties globally
- Macroeconomic hedge demand
Unlike fiat currencies stabilized by:
- Central bank interventions
- Legal tender laws
- Government tax requirements
Frequently Asked Questions
Q1: How does Bitcoin differ from traditional money?
Bitcoin operates without central authority, using cryptographic proofs instead of institutional trust. Its supply schedule is algorithmically fixed, unlike inflation-prone fiat currencies.
Q2: Is Bitcoin truly anonymous?
Bitcoin offers pseudonymity—wallet addresses don't directly identify users, but sophisticated chain analysis can potentially reveal transaction patterns when combined with other data.
Q3: Why does Bitcoin mining consume so much energy?
The proof-of-work system intentionally makes mining computationally difficult to secure the network against attacks and maintain decentralized consensus without intermediaries.

The Road Ahead for Bitcoin
As blockchain's flagship application, Bitcoin continues evolving through:
- Layer 2 scaling solutions (Lightning Network)
- Institutional custody services
- Regulatory clarity developments
- Merchant adoption tools
Its long-term success will depend on balancing the original decentralized vision with practical usability requirements for mainstream adoption.
